Second Forum for Corporate Foundations

On the 17th of October, our chairman Emilia Gromadowska took part in the Second Forum for Corporate Foundations. Over a hundred other NGO representatives discussed volunteer work, strategy, public image and working with other non-profit organizations. They exchanged knowledge about developing effective programs and facing common challenges. The Center for Research and Social Innovation Stocznia conducted a lecture about bridging gaps in equal access to education and the effect of educational reforms on society. The presented research results confirmed that it is important to focus on helping young Poles in obtaining the best education possible, even though the financial situation of Polish families is improving. However, there is still very few young people (whose parents finished their education on a high school level) who decide to continue their education at universities (only 10% of respondents). The meeting confirmed our confidence in our scholarship program at the EFC Foundation. It continuously responds to one of the most important social issues discussed - bridging the educational gap among young students.
